Abstract

When a moving body is remotely operated, a delay in transmission of an image and information acquired from the moving body becomes a problem since immediate transmission of an operation to the moving body cannot be expected. When a frame rate is decreased or a resolution is reduced to decrease the amount of image data to prevent transmission delay of the image data, it is difficult to grasp motions of other moving bodies. As a result, when a certain amount of time is required to transmit a camera image and a moving obstacle, the movement of the obstacle and the movement of the moving body are estimated. The estimated image is generated based on a current image, and is presented to an operator via a monitor. Accordingly, it is possible to reduce instability and a risk associated with transmission delay to safely operate the moving body.
